Each year, WORLDSymposium identifies an unmet need, or critical topic for presentation and discussion in the Annual Robert J. Gorlin Symposium. For 2025, this non-CE session will be: The Situation Room: Gene Therapy in the Real World. This intensive 75-minute panel discussion will address the hottest controversies in gene therapy. Expert panelists –trailblazers with global perspectives — will focus on the contentious implications of the economic, regulatory and ethical dimensions of single-administration (“one-and-done”) treatments. The Annual Robert J. Gorlin Symposium was established in 2022 to honor the work of Robert James Gorlin, DDS, PhD. Dr. Gorlin was a geneticist, maxillofacial pathologist, and academician at the University of Minnesota School of Dentistry. Spanning over 50 years, his groundbreaking research in genetic disorders of the head and neck revolutionized the understanding of the morphology of lysosomal diseases and many other genetic disorders.
